Implementation Manager MM35972491
8 Month Contract
Hybrid in Boston, MA
Summary: Serve as an Implementation Manager for applications and technologies within Protection New Business and Underwriting. Directly support the overall Underwriting organization with a focus on our Platform Modernization. Role includes new system implementations, API implementations and Policy and Procedure implementations. Underwriting platform experience preferred. Must be able to work in a dynamic, matrixed organization, bringing together the perspectives of many and the End-to-End requirements across the customer experience for successful operations implementation.
